What Is Loaded Breakfast Tostadas?

Loaded Breakfast Tostadas are a delightful Mexican-inspired breakfast dish featuring crispy tostada shells topped with fluffy scrambled eggs, savory black beans, and a medley of cheeses, fresh vegetables, and zesty salsa. They are a quick and satisfying meal perfect for any time of day. For more information on Mexican cuisine, you can explore resources on Mexican food.

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Servings: 4 tostadas

Ingredients You’ll Need

  • 4 tostada shells (crisp and ready for topping)
  • 4 large eggs (for fluffy scrambled eggs)
  • 2 tablespoons butter (for cooking the eggs)
  • 1 cup black beans (drained for a protein boost)
  • ½ cup shredded cheddar cheese (for a sharp, tangy flavor)
  • ½ c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ese (for creaminess)
  • 1 avocado (sliced for creaminess and healthy fats)
  • ½ cup salsa (for a zesty kick)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ro (chopped for freshness)
  • 2 green onions (chopped for a mild onion flavor)
  • Salt to taste (to enhance flavors)
  • Pepper to taste (for a bit of spice)
  • Hot sauce (optional, for those who like it spicy)

Feel free to substitute the cheeses with your favorites, or use egg whites for a lighter version. Quality ingredients will elevate your tostadas, so opt for fresh vegetables and good-quality eggs whenever possible. Enjoy personalizing this dish to suit your taste!

Step-by-Step Instructions

Preparing the Ingredients

  1. Gather all your ingredients and make sure they are prepped and ready to go. This includes draining the black beans, chopping the cilantro and green onions, and slicing the avocado.
  2.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) if you plan to warm the tostada shells in the oven.
  3. In a small bowl, mix the chopped cilantro and green onions together. This will be your fresh garnish for the tostadas.

Pro Tip: Preparing all your ingredients ahead of time will make the cooking process smoother and more enjoyable!

Cooking the Eggs

  1. In a sk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. You’ll know it’s ready when it starts to bubble gently.
  2. Crack the eggs into the skillet, being careful not to break the yolks if you want them sunny side up. For scrambled eggs, whisk them in a bowl beforehand.
  3. Cook the eggs until the whites are set and the yolks reach your desired doneness, about 3-5 minutes for sunny side up and around 2-3 minutes for scrambled.

Pro Tip: For fluffier scrambled eggs, whisk in a splash of milk or cream before cooking!

Assembling the Tostadas

  1. If you’re using the oven, place the tostada shells on a baking sheet and warm them in the oven for about 5 minutes until crispy.
  2. Once the tostada shells are ready, layer each one starting with a generous spoonful of black beans.
  3. Next, add the eggs on top of the beans. If you prefer scrambled eggs, just spoon them over the beans.
  4. Sprinkle both the cheddar and Monterey Jack cheese over the eggs, allowing them to melt slightly from the heat.
  5. Add slices of avocado, followed by a drizzle of salsa for that zesty kick.
  6. Finally, sprinkle the chopped cilantro and green onions on top, and season with salt, pepper, and a dash of hot sauce if desired.

Pro Tip: To keep the tostadas crispy, serve them immediately after assembling!

Serving and Storage Tips

Serving

Serve your Loaded Breakfast Tostadas warm, topped with additional salsa and a sprinkle of fresh cilantro. Pair them with a side of fresh fruit or a light salad for a complete meal. They’re perfect for brunch gatherings or a cozy family breakfast! For more breakfast ideas, explore our breakfast recipes.

Storage

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. For best results, reheat the tostadas in the oven to maintain their crispiness. Avoid freezing, as the toppings may become soggy upon thawing.

Common Mistakes

  • Overcooking the eggs: Keep an eye on them to achieve the perfect texture; remove them from the heat just as they set.
  • Not warming the tostada shells: Warming enhances their crunch; don’t skip this step!
  • Skipping seasoning: A little salt and pepper makes a big difference in flavor; don’t forget to taste as you go.
  • Assembling too early: Build your tostadas just before serving to keep them crispy and fresh!

Frequently Asked Questions

Can the recipe be frozen?

While Loaded Breakfast Tostadas are best enjoyed fresh, you can freeze the components separately. Store the tostada shells and toppings in airtight containers. When you’re ready to enjoy, reheat the shells and assemble the toppings fresh for the best texture.

Can ingredients be substituted?

Absolutely! You can swap the black beans for pinto or refried beans, and feel free to use any cheese varieties you prefer. If you’re out of eggs, consider using tofu or egg substitutes for a different twist.

How to store leftovers?

Store any uneaten tostadas in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. To maintain their crunch, keep the toppings separate until you’re ready to eat.

Can the recipe be made ahead?

Yes! You can prepare the ingredients ahead of time. Cook the eggs and beans, and chop the veggies, then store them in the fridge. This makes for a quick assembly in the morning!
